DocumentCode :
2590587
Title :
A comparative study of five regression testing algorithms
Author :
Baradhi, Ghinwa ; Mansour, Nashat
Author_Institution :
Dept. of Comput. Sci., Lebanese American Univ., Lebanon
fYear :
1997
fDate :
29 Sep-2 Oct 1997
Firstpage :
174
Lastpage :
182
Abstract :
We compare five regression testing algorithms that include: slicing, incremental, firewall, genetic and simulated annealing algorithms. The comparison is based on the following ten quantitative and qualitative criteria: execution time, number of selected retests, precision, inclusiveness, user parameters, handling of global variables, type of maintenance, type of testing, level of testing, and type of approach. The experimental results show that the five algorithms are suitable for different requirements of regression testing. Nevertheless, the incremental algorithm shows more favorable properties than the others
Keywords :
genetic algorithms; program testing; simulated annealing; software maintenance; software performance evaluation; statistical analysis; execution time; firewall; genetic algorithms; global variables; inclusiveness; incremental algorithm; maintenance; precision; regression testing algorithms; retests; simulated annealing; slicing algorithm; user parameters; Computational modeling; Computer science; Computer simulation; Data analysis; Genetics; Linear programming; Partitioning algorithms; Simulated annealing; Software maintenance; Testing;
fLanguage :
English
Publisher :
ieee
Conference_Titel :
Software Engineering Conference, 1997. Proceedings., Australian
Conference_Location :
Sydney, NSW
Print_ISBN :
0-8186-8081-4
Type :
conf
DOI :
10.1109/ASWEC.1997.623769
Filename :
623769
Link To Document :
بازگشت